A man caught hiding a loaded gun in his Southall bedroom has been given five years in prison.

Aaron Kelly, 27, of Beaconsfield Road, received the sentence after police raided his home, initially looking for drugs.

A Somali man was beaten and stripped naked by two men before being left in a Southall street, Isleworth Crown Court heard last Friday.

Mohamed Hassan, 23, of Tudor Road, Hayes, and Kashif Sayed, 22, of Harrow Road, Wembley, admitted a charge of common assault on the unknown man on May 29 last year.

Parking misery in Southall could be eased under a new scheme being piloted by Ealing Council.

Fifty car parking spaces will be available at Southall Conservative Club shortly, for £1 an hour or £5 a day.

The new police inspector for Southall said he wants to enlist the community and young people in fighting crime in the area.

Insp Rob Bryan, who has been on the force since 1989, asked to be posted in the area as he had patrolled the streets of Ealing as a PC in the mid 1990s.
